Wie Sie Plugins auf Ihrem Quake Live Server installieren
In diesem Guide lernen Sie, wie Sie Plugins auf Ihrem Quake Live Server mit MinQLX installieren.
MinQLX aktivieren
Abschnitt mit dem Titel "MinQLX aktivieren"MinQLX ist das Framework, das es Plugins ermöglicht, mit Quake Live zu interagieren. Standardmäßig haben wir MinQLX auf jeder Game Host Bros Quake Live Instanz installiert. Es muss nur aktiviert werden.
- Laden Sie das Game Host Bros Panel und wählen Sie Ihren Server aus.
- Gehen Sie im linken Menü zu
Configuration > Startup Parameters
. - Suchen Sie nach
MinQLX
und schalten Sie es ein. - Starten Sie Ihren Quake Live Server neu.
Sie können dies jederzeit ausschalten, wenn Sie aus irgendeinem Grund zur Vanilla QL Version zurückkehren müssen.
Plugins installieren
Abschnitt mit dem Titel "Plugins installieren"- Laden Sie das Game Host Bros Panel und wählen Sie Ihren Server aus.
- Klicken Sie im linken Menü auf
Management > File Manager
. - Öffnen Sie den
minqlx-plugins
Ordner. - Ziehen Sie Ihre Plugin .py Datei hinein.
- Gehen Sie im linken Menü zu
Configuration > Startup Parameters
. - Suchen Sie nach MinQLX Plugins und fügen Sie Ihren Plugin-Namen am Ende der Liste hinzu.
- Starten Sie Ihren Server neu.
Bitte stellen Sie sicher, dass Sie die Anweisungen für jedes Plugin befolgen, da einige zusätzliche Abhängigkeiten zu minqlx-plugins/requirements.txt
hinzugefügt werden müssen. Diese Datei wird jedes Mal überprüft, wenn Ihr Server mit aktiviertem MinQLX Mod gestartet wird.
Quake Live Plugins Liste
Abschnitt mit dem Titel "Quake Live Plugins Liste"Unten ist eine Liste aller aktuellen Quake Live Plugins, die Sie manuell auf Ihrem Server installieren können.
Es gibt einige andere Ressourcen, von denen Sie Plugins erhalten können:
Name | Beschreibung | Autor |
---|---|---|
afk | AFK-Personen erkennen und sie in den Zuschauermodus versetzen (nach einer Warnung). | iouonegirl |
aliases | Eine Liste der Namen anzeigen, unter denen ein Spieler auf dem aktuellen Server gespielt hat. | tjone270 |
auto_rebalance | Erweiterung zum Balance-Plugin, die automatisch zwei neue Beitreter für bessere Team-Durchschnitte ausbalanciert und !teams am Rundenende aufruft, wenn ein Team derzeit dominiert | ShiN0 |
autoready | bereitet das Spiel automatisch nach einer konfigurierbaren Zeit vor, die vergangen ist, mit einigen zentrierten Ankündigungen, sobald eine bestimmte Mindestanzahl von Spielern auf dem Server erreicht wurde. | ShiN0 |
autorestart | Startet einen Server zu einer bestimmten Zeit automatisch neu, wenn niemand verbunden ist. | tjone270 |
autospec | Erkennt ungleiche Teams und versetzt die Person, die zuletzt beigetreten ist, in den Zuschauermodus. | iouonegirl |
banvote | Spieler vom Abstimmen ausschließen | kanzo |
bot_antispec | behebt Bug mit bot_minplayers und Teamgrößen kleiner als Spielerlimit, der Bots zum Zuschauen bringt (kickt sie) | roast |
botmanager | Nützliches Bot-Management-Plugin, einschließlich Bot-Map-Support-Überprüfung, automatische Teamausgleichung durch Hinzufügen eines Bots, Bot-Hinzufügen/Entfernen-Befehle/Abstimmungen etc. | tjone270 |
branding | Markiert Ihren Server mit benutzerdefiniertem Text beim Kartenladebildschirm/Scoreboard. | tjone270 |
centerprint | Wichtige Nachrichten auf den Bildschirmen der Spieler übertragen. Eine ‘letzter Feind steht’ Nachricht umschalten. | iouonegirl |
changemap | Ändert die Karte, wenn niemand mit dem Server verbunden ist. | tjone270 |
checkplayers | Alle Spieler mit Berechtigung>=1, gebannte, Verlasser-gebannte, Verlasser-verwarnte und stumm geschaltete Spieler auflisten. Basiert auf x0rnn’s checkplayers, aber komplett neu geschrieben, um scan_iter zu verwenden und als Tabelle auszugeben. Behebt auch Spieler-Disconnects bei großer Ausgabe, IRC-Flooding und andere Probleme. | kanzo |
coinprice | Bitcoin/Ethereum/Litecoin Preis überprüfen (!btc, !eth, !ltc oder !bitcoin, !ethereum, !litecoin). | x0rnn |
commands | Listet minqlx-Befehle auf, die auf dem Server verfügbar sind. | BarelyMiSSeD |
commlink | Bietet ein Inter-Server-Kommunikationssystem für eine Gruppe von Servern. | tjone270 |
crash | !crash für zufällige Crash-Noob-Intro-Sounds :D | roast |
custom_votes | Fügt zusätzliche Abstimmungsfunktionalität zu Ihren Servern hinzu. | tjone270 |
custom_modes_vote | Fügt zusätzliche Spielmodi wie PQL zu Ihren Servern hinzu. | ShiN0 |
disable_commands | Befehle deaktivieren und eine Nachricht anzeigen, wenn ein deaktivierter Befehl ausgeführt wird. | tjone270 |
disable_votes | Abstimmungen während eines Matches deaktivieren. | iouonegirl |
discordbot | Spielstatistiken ausgeben, Verbindungslinks zu Ihrem Discord Server. Kann optional auch Spielchat an Discord senden. | roast |
duke | Duke Nukem Sound-Trigger! | roast |
dynamicip | Aktualisiert Server-IP im qlstats Admin Panel vor Spielbeginn. Nützlich für Server mit dynamischer IP-Adresse. | eugene |
elocheck | Überprüft die Elos eines Spielers gegen qlstats und listet ihre a- und b-Elos auf sowie die Suche nach anderen Verbindungen von denselben IPs | ShiN0 |
english | English motherf*cker, do you speak it? (auch “Denied!” aus Q3 und stfu.wav hinzugefügt) | x0rnn |
fastvotes | Beschleunigt Abstimmung bestehen/fehlschlagen mit verschiedenen Optionen, z.B. basierend auf einem Unterschiedsschwellenwert zwischen bestehen oder fehlschlagen. | ShiN0 |
frag_stats | Statistiken von geernteten Seelen und Ernter deiner Seelen pro Karte sowie insgesamt | ShiN0 |
funlimit | Deaktiviert automatisch fun(.py) Sounds während eines Matches/Runden. | iouonegirl |
funstuff | verschiedene lustige Abstimmungsfunktionen - beinhaltet slaphappy, hulk, gay, rename, purgatory und kill | roast |
gauntonly | Wenn eine CA-Runde zu 1vX geht, wird der Gauntlet-Only-Modus aktiviert. | iouonegirl |
gravityfixer | stellt die Schwerkraft nach Karten mit benutzerdefinierter Schwerkraft wieder normal her | roast |
gungames | benutzerdefinierte Abstimmungs-Trigger für Gungames Factories | roast |
handicap | Fügt automatische Benachteiligung von hochrangigen Spielern zum Server hinzu. Nützlich, wenn Sie den Server für alle öffnen möchten, ohne zerstört zu werden. | BarelyMiSSeD |
intermission | Schleift über eine Liste von Musik und spielt eine bei jedem Match-Ende. | iouonegirl |
intermissionplus | Erlaubt Spielern, benutzerdefinierte Siegeslieder einzustellen (zusätzlich zur normalen Intermission-Funktionalität). | roast |
ips | Eine Liste der IP-Adressen anzeigen, mit denen sich ein Spieler auf dem aktuellen Server verbunden hat. | tjone270 |
kamikaze_clanarena | Aktiviert Kamikaze im Clan Arena Spieltyp. Siehe Details | eugene |
killingspree | Unreal Tournament Ankündigungen für 5/10/15/20/25/30 Kills in Folge und multi(3)/mega(4)/ultra(5)/monster(6)/ludicrous(7)/holyshit(8) Kills in 3/4 Sekunden Intervallen | x0rnn |
listmaps | Erlaubt Spielern, eine Liste der auf dem Server verfügbaren Karten zu sehen. | BarelyMiSSeD |
map_config | Lädt Konfigurationsdatei abhängig von der laufenden Karte | eugene |
mapoo | erlaubt mehrere Mappool-Dateien, die sich automatisch basierend auf der Spielerzahl ändern | roast |
midair | Rankt Raketen-Midair-Kills, “Holy shit” Ansager bei jedem Midair-Frag, der die Kriterien erfüllt. | x0rnn |
midair_only | Wie oben, aber ändert das Gameplay in einen Nur-Raketen-Modus, wo nur Midair-Raketen töten können. | x0rnn |
motd | Ein Ersatz-Motd-Plugin, das mehrere Motd/Willkommens-Sounds ermöglicht. | roast |
mybalance | Fügt ELO/GLICKO-Beschränkungen und Spec/Slay-Optionen für ungleiche Teams hinzu. Funktioniert jetzt für alle Spieltypen! Zeigt Ready-up-Erinnerungen! Autoshuffle + Balance-Option. | iouonegirl |
myban | Erlaubt es Ihnen, Spieler nach Namen zu bannen. | iouonegirl |
mydiscordbot | Discord-Integration, die es Ihnen ermöglicht, zwischen Discord und Quake Live Spielern zu chatten, mit unterstützten benutzerdefinierten Erweiterungen. | ShiN0 |
myessentials | Erlaubt die Verwendung von Namen in Befehlen wie !kick, !red, !spec, … | iouonegirl |
myFun | Sounds von Soundpacks auf Ihrem Server abspielen. Ersetzt fun.py mit mehr Features und Sounds (kann gewählte Soundpacks aktivieren/deaktivieren). | BarelyMiSSeD |
nextmap | Nextmap ankündigen und Nextmap-Wiederholungen beheben. | roast |
nospec | Verhindert, dass Personen ohne Berechtigungen zuschauen, während das Match läuft. | admafi |
onjoin | Zeigt eine gespeicherte Nachricht von einem Spieler an, wenn er sich mit einem Server verbindet. | tjone270 |
permaban | Bannt Spieler dauerhaft gründlich, durch Querverweise von Steam IDs über IPs. | tjone270 |
player_info | Zeigt Informationen über Spieler an (optional beim Verbinden). Statistiken von Personen ‘unter’ dem Scoreboard in großen Matches anzeigen. Spieler mit deaktivierten qlstats-Konten warnen/bannen. | iouonegirl |
protect | Spieler vor Callvote-Kicks vom Server schützen und mehr. | BarelyMiSSeD |
pummel | Fügt eine Spieler vs Spieler Zählung erfolgreicher Gauntlet-Frags hinzu. | mattiZed |
q3resolver | Erlaubt Spielern /cv map q3dm6/andere Q3 Kartennamen, und löst sie zu QL Kartennamen auf. | tjone270 |
qlstats_privacy_policy | erzwingt, dass Spieler qlstats Datenschutzrichtlinien-Einstellungen gesetzt haben, bevor sie spielen können. | ShiN0 |
queue | 2.0 Version fügt ein Duell-ähnliches Warteschlangen-System zu Ihren Servern hinzu. | Melodeiro |
quiet | Verhindert, dass Spieler /say, /say_team oder /tell während Matches verwenden. | tjone270 |
ragespec | !ragespec zu…ragespec! | roast |
railable | Möglichkeit, eine anpassbare Nachricht auf Ihrem Bildschirm zu zeigen, wenn Ihre Gesundheit unter railable fällt. | iouonegirl |
ratinglimiter | Verhindert, dass Spieler mit Glicko über/unter gesetzten Limits auf dem Server spielen. | tjone270 |
referee | Gibt Schiedsrichter-Status an jemanden mit dem Passwort oder einen, der zum Schiedsrichter gewählt wurde. | x0rnn |
scores | Zeigt Spieler/Team-Informationen wie Kills, Tode, gegebenen Schaden, erhaltenen Schaden, Elos, durchschnittliches Team-Elo, etc. Siehe: http://imgur.com/a/s2suj | x0rnn |
servers | Fügt !servers Befehl hinzu, der den Status von Servern zeigt. | kanzo |
sets | Erlaubt Spielern, einige ununterbrochene Duell-Sets zu spielen (Bo3, Bo5, …). Informiert auch verbindende Spieler, dass ein Set aktiv ist. | iouonegirl |
spec999 | !spec999, Spieler mit 999 Ping in den Zuschauermodus versetzen. | x0rnn |
specprotect | Zuschauer vor dem Erhalt einer Kick-Callvote schützen. | iouonegirl |
specs | !specs: Spieler auflisten, die dir zuschauen; !specwho x: zeigen, wem x zuschaut; !specall: zeigen, wem jeder Zuschauer zuschaut. | x0rnn |
stats | Einige einfache Kill-Statistiken anzeigen: Kills, Tode, K/D-Verhältnis, Kills pro Minute. | x0rnn |
sv_fps | Erlaubt es Ihnen, die Spielserver-Framerate sicher einzustellen. | tjone270 |
thirtysecwarn | Gibt eine 30-Sekunden-Warnung 30 Sekunden vor Rundenende aus, konfigurierbar für verschiedene Stimmstile. | ShiN0 |
titlerank | Gibt einem Spieler einen Titelrang und wird als solcher begrüßt, wenn der Spieler dem Server beitritt. | x0rnn |
translate | Wörter und Sätze in andere Sprachen übersetzen! Die letzten Dinge übersetzen, die jemand gesagt hat! Schlägt auch Urban-Definitionen nach. | iouonegirl |
tts | Primitives TTS (Text-to-Speech) System basierend auf Arpabet (https://en.wikipedia.org/wiki/Arpabet) | x0rnn |
uberstats | verschiedene Stats/Auszeichnungen während und am Ende des Spiels vergeben | roast |
uneventeams | Bestraft den Spieler mit der geringsten Spielzeit im größeren Team. Funktioniert für alle Spieltypen. Für nicht-rundenbasierte Spieltypen mit dem queue.py Plugin verwenden. | mattiZed |
urltitle | Druckt den Titel einer Website/YouTube-Link, etc. im Chat gepostet. | x0rnn |
vote | Fügt einige weitere Callvotes hinzu, wie PQL/VQL, LG Schaden 6/7, etc. Mehr auf Duell zugeschnitten. | x0rnn |
votemanager | Erlaubt minqlx perm3 Spielern, eine Abstimmung mit einem zweiten Drücken von F1/F2 zu erzwingen. | tjone270 |
votestats | Entfernt Wähler-Anonymität und zeigt nützliche kartenändernde Nachrichten für diejenigen, die die Abstimmung verpasst haben. | tjone270 |
warn | Einen Spieler für Fehlverhalten warnen. X Verstöße und du bist raus (gebannt)! | x0rnn |
weaponspawnfixer | überschreibt karten-erzwungene Waffen-Spawn-Zeiten | roast |
weather | Wetter und Vorhersage im Spiel überprüfen! | roast |
winneranthem | Spielt Hymne für das Siegerland am Ende des Matches! | roast |